Where do I find my Oral B model number?

This will identify which model of electric toothbrush you have. It is a 4-digit number which can be found on the underside of your toothbrush and is highlighted by the red arrows below. The Type Number should also be listed on the user manual for your toothbrush.

What is the lifespan of an Oral-B electric toothbrush?

around 5 years
The average life span of an electric toothbrush is around 5 years. Manufacturers normally offer a 2 year warranty should the brush fail sooner. But some brushes will last a lot longer — we know of people still using electric toothbrushes that are 10 years old.

Should I keep my toothbrush on the charger?

It is perfectly safe to disconnect the power and leave the brush fitted to the charging stand. Doing so will keep the toothbrush upright and reduce any potential risk and damage to the toothbrush. Leaving the power cable connected is generally fine also, but it is not necessarily required.

Is Braun owned by Oral-B?

The first product was known as the “Oral-B 60”, because it had 60 tufts. Oral-B became part of the Gillette group in 1984. Braun, also part of the Gillette group at that time, started to use the Oral-B brand for electric toothbrushes. Oral-B has been part of the Procter & Gamble company since 2006.

What is the Braun Oral-B magnetic charging stand?

An official Braun Oral-B part. This is a new style of magnetic charging stand introduced in 2020, with the Oral-B iO. The stand allows the toothbrush to be charged in as little as 3 hours. The toothbrush can be positioned at any angle on the stand and will be stood upright, secured in place by magnets.
